fused stamens?


I'm a bit worried about my Mackenzie 1010.  It's about 10' now and has
produced very few male flowers and each male flower has had the same
peculiar mutation: each have had at least part of the stamen fused to
the inside of a petal, making the flower mishapened.

I hope that when the three female buds on the plant open (within a week
or so) that 1) I actually have male flowers around, 2) that mishapened
male flowers still produce decent pollen and 3) that the female lobes
will be normal.

Has anyone experienced anything like this before?
